### Alert: MarkdownRenderLatencyHigh

Fires when p95 render time in the Inkwell markdown pipeline exceeds 2.5s for 10 consecutive minutes. Usual causes: oversized embedded tables, sanitizer regressions, or a stuck worker in the render pool. Check worker queue depth first, then recent deploys to the sanitizer service. Restarting the pool is safe and idempotent. If latency persists after a restart, escalate to the pipeline owners at the address below.

escalation mailbox, yajeg-bageg: quenax.olidor@lumiccorp.internal

# Capacity Decision — Morrow Forge (Managers Only)

Following sustained demand for the Keelbar line, leadership is weighing expansion of the Ashgrove plant versus contracting overflow to Penhallow Castings. Cost models favour expansion over a three-year horizon; contracting wins on flexibility. Heads of department should review assumptions before Friday. The confidential business note appended below frames the decision.

confidential, kajof-tahof: The pricing group signed off on a budget of $491.8 million for Project Casvan.

## Action Item 4: Raise batch guardrails on Quillstack imports

Following the Harrowfield catalogue outage, the import pipeline must reject oversized record batches before they reach the dedup stage rather than after. Owner: platform team; target: next minor release. The release manager should confirm the new guardrail values ship behind the existing feature flag and are documented in the runbook. The revised limits we agreed on are as follows.

tuning table, yajog-yahof:
BUDGETS = {
    "lamvan": 303,
    "wenox": 460,
    "fenvan": 525,
}

Ticket FNX-2291: Backpressure for notification fan-out — sign-off needed

For new team members: the Heraldo notification service fans out each event to push, email, and in-app channels. Under spiky load, the fan-out workers overwhelm the downstream delivery pool, causing timeouts and duplicate sends. This ticket adds a token-bucket backpressure gate with per-channel limits and a dead-letter path for overflow. The change touches retry semantics, so it cannot ship without explicit review. Sign-off is required from the engineer named below.

named custodian: Belius Casath Ulaix Sorius